Indulge in remarkable luxury and immerse yourself in the tropical paradise that is Cancun. Highly-regarded all-inclusive resorts offer a captivating array of features to cater your every whim.
Relax on white sand https://haimarhnt531222.blogprodesign.com/61307181/escape-at-luxury-all-inclusive-cancun-resorts